Quest Atlantis

Quest Atlantis (QA) was a 3D multiuser, computer graphics learning environment that utilized a narrative programming toolkit to immerse children, ages 9–16, in meaningful inquiry tasks.

The project was intended to engage children ages 9–16 in a form of transformational play comprising both online and offline learning activities, with a storyline inspiring a disposition towards social action.

Students and teachers conduct rich inquiry-based explorations through which they learn particular standards-based content while developing pro-social attitudes regarding significant environmental and social issues (see Critical Design Article).

The principal investigator was Sasha Barab,[1] Associate Professor in Learning Sciences, now at Arizona State University Center for Games and Impact.

Other faculty members who played prominent roles in the project included Dan Hickey at Indiana University-Bloomington and Melissa Gresalfi at Vanderbilt University.
